Another boxing bet for Saturday. Kell Brook by decision 10/11at Boyles (4/6 best elsewhere). First fight ended up going to points after Brook controlled the first half before gassing badly in the later rounds. Despite controlling the early rounds he never really looked like stopping Jones. It's also a 10 rounder whereas their first fight was over 12 rounds. I see Brook winning on points but by a wider margin this time, something like 98-92. Recommend £55 at 10/11

A question for punters, as I am getting confused with returns from bets.
I moslty go via Hills and they go best guaranteed odds, etc.
But numerous times I am backing at a price and it gets bigger and finishes bigger on the horse race, then I am still not getting paid at best guaranteed odds. I keep asking why and they mention it's something to do with when the odds was captured. Like I have just been on a horse at 4/7, it has gone off at 4/7, they have given me 8/13..... Should I be getting 4/6? This is happening numerous times & I do not know if it is right what they are saying or not?
Cheers in advance

If you are betting on the day and not ante-post you should get the SP price if its bigger than the price you took. There are no edxceptions as long as its UK & Ireland racing I don't think
